Position Overview

Client is seeking an experienced Systems Administrator to maintain and expand a heterogeneous computing environment supporting advanced cyber system assessment research. This role supports Linux, Windows, macOS, VMware platforms, and specialized test equipment in air‑gapped and secure environments.

The Systems Administrator will act as a technology consultant to researchers and project teams, with a primary focus on Ubuntu Linux systems.


Background / Mission

The Cyber System Assessments Group provides independent cyber system evaluations for the U.S. Government, conducting cutting-edge research in cyber operations, red teaming, vulnerability discovery, reverse engineering, forensic analysis, and realistic high-fidelity cyber test environments.
